Macy's

Macy's is an American department chain of stores and its flagship store in Herald Square is regarded as one of the largest stores in the United States. It has a broad selection of items, including clothes and footwear, accessories, cosmetics, and home goods. The company also has several stores across the nation in addition to its main location in the United States.

In the 1800s, Rowland Hussey Macy founded a department store in New York City. Macy is credited with many innovations that have created the modern department store as we see it today, including using cash-only transactions and establishing a system of one-price shopping. Macy also introduced standardized pricing for newspapers in the US and was among the first stores to offer money-back guarantees. He also created a custom-made clothing service and also created the Christmas window display, which is still a fixture at Macy's stores today.

Nordstrom

Nordstrom is a department store that sells fashionable clothing and accessories for men, women children, and babies. The company is located in Seattle, Washington, and has a number of stores across the US. The company also offers online shopping and mobile apps. The products offered include clothing bags, shoes and accessories, bath and body and accessories for homes, as well as food and beauty products. Nordstrom offers a variety of services including styling, pickup of orders for alteration, and dining services. It also owns and operates the retail brand Zella.

Nordstrom's online sales make up more than 30 percent of the company's revenue. The retailer aims to offer an experience that is as close as possible to the Nordstrom in-store experience.
